Output 8b5ad816980716d58de4a824d1245d5a559e175b6fde7d2934403b01b9b96a5f:0

value
44173396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d674dedec1e44b4dd2554b89b55bb4b05d4ae09d OP_EQUAL
address
3MExXuWcqwZC6nLbAGZxjAFk9sf3z49LNZ
transaction
8b5ad816980716d58de4a824d1245d5a559e175b6fde7d2934403b01b9b96a5f
spent
true